Small and medium-sized businesses (such as network administrators, installers, and other technical organizations) may now arrange hydrogen training courses for their employees, conduct physical testing, and exhibit their expertise through the new Hydrogen Innovation Network Groningen (WING). The test network may be located at EnTranCe – Center of Expertise Energy of the Hanze University of Applied Sciences Groningen’s energy transition testing ground.
